EXPLORE THE VAST KNOWLEDGE CONSISTED OF WITHIN THE WEB SOLUTIONS HANDBOOK, COVERING ALL ASPECTS OF INTERACTION METHODS

Explore The Vast Knowledge Consisted Of Within The Web Solutions Handbook, Covering All Aspects Of Interaction Methods

Explore The Vast Knowledge Consisted Of Within The Web Solutions Handbook, Covering All Aspects Of Interaction Methods

Blog Article

Material By-Schou Shaffer

Discover the ultimate Internet Solutions Manual for all your needs. Explore communication procedures, core ideas of SOAP and remainder, and ideal practices for seamless implementation. Uncover the secrets to mastering internet services, from understanding the basics to executing scalable architecture. Master the art of creating protected systems and enhancing for future growth. Unlock the power of internet solutions within your reaches.

Review of Internet Services



If you have actually ever before wondered what internet services are and how they function, this review is the perfect location to begin. https://www.peoplematters.in/news/leadership/deutsche-bahn-india-names-muukesh-gupta-as-new-head-of-human-resource-34477 are a method for various applications to communicate with each other online. They permit smooth assimilation of systems, making it easier to share information and functionalities.

Among the essential elements of internet solutions is their use of basic procedures like HTTP and XML to facilitate communication. This standardization guarantees that different systems can understand and communicate with each other effectively. Web services can be classified right into 2 primary kinds: SOAP (Simple Things Access Procedure) and REST (Representational State Transfer).

SOAP is a procedure that makes use of XML for message exchange, while REST relies upon typical HTTP techniques like GET, POST, PUT, and erase. Both have their staminas and are utilized in different situations based upon needs.

Key Concepts and Technologies



Exploring the fundamental principles and innovations of internet solutions is vital for understanding their performance and application in modern systems. When delving into the vital principles and technologies of web services, you open the door to a globe of interconnected possibilities. Below are some essential elements to realize:

- ** SOAP (Simple Object Accessibility Procedure) **: This procedure specifies the structure of messages traded in between internet solutions.
- ** WSDL (Internet Providers Description Language) **: WSDL is used to define the functionalities offered by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that uses common HTTP methods for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between web services as a result of its adaptability and readability.

Recognizing seo for companies and modern technologies will lay a strong foundation for your journey right into the world of internet services.

Best Practices for Implementation



To make certain successful implementation of internet solutions, prioritize adherence to finest practices. Begin by completely documenting your internet service APIs, consisting of clear descriptions of endpoints, criteria, and anticipated feedbacks. Regular naming conventions and versioning of APIs are critical for maintainability. When making your internet services, adhere to the principles of REST to create a scalable and adaptable design. Apply appropriate authentication and permission mechanisms to safeguard your solutions, such as OAuth or API keys.

Evaluating is essential in making sure the reliability of your internet solutions. Create comprehensive test cases that cover different scenarios, consisting of favorable and negative screening. Constant assimilation and automated screening can assist catch concerns early in the growth procedure. Monitor your web solutions in real-time to identify performance traffic jams and potential failings. Logging and mistake handling are essential for diagnosing concerns and fixing troubles effectively.


Last but not least, think about the scalability of your internet solutions by designing for future development. Apply caching mechanisms and lots balancing to take care of raised traffic. On a regular basis evaluation and maximize your code for performance. By adhering to these finest methods, you can simplify the implementation of internet solutions and guarantee their success.

Verdict

Congratulations! You have actually just opened the key to understanding internet services. By understanding the crucial concepts and innovations, and applying ideal methods, you're well on your method to becoming an internet services professional.

Maintain checking out and experimenting with what you have actually discovered to continue broadening your knowledge and skills in this amazing area.

The globe of web services is now within your reaches, all set for you to check out and dominate. Enjoy the trip!